The righteous man who walks in integrity and lives life in accord with his [godly] beliefs-- How blessed [happy and spiritually secure] are his children after him [who have his example to follow]. PROVERBS 20:7 AMP
The Righteous - it has nothing to do with personal achievement or efforts; it has all to do with who God is. When a man is referred to as 'Righteous', it is not about the man's ability but God's capacity and empowerment. I do not come seeking God on my own terms; I seek him on his own terms. When the identity is right, then the lifestyle will be right. The Righteous man lives on the strength of the inner Presence. His life is guided by the One who is able to sustain and uphold him.
Life itself is also an investment. All I do is a seed of a kind; and there will be a harvest of the seeds sometime in the future. It does not matter how long it takes or how well the seeds are hidden; someone somewhere will reap the benefits or detriments of the actions being done now. My parents could do their own part, I have a choice to follow. I must also remember that just as I go will reap from the labour of my parents, so would the children coming after me do the same. I had better live right. His time of favour is here.
